Felony Charges of Assault and Battery on an Elderly Person Against Investment Banker Dismissed
Our client works in the financial services industry and has been managing large funds for nearly three decades. About a year and half ago he was at a local bar enjoying food and drinks with some friends. Just before leaving the establishment our client went to the bathroom. On his way out he and another individual collided. Our client apologized. The other individual became aggressive. Our client believed that he was about to be struck by this man so he hit him first. Several patrons and staff members saw what our client did. However, they did not see what prompted this. The police were called and our client was charged with assault and battery on a elderly person causing bodily injury in violation of G.L. c. 265 section 13K. That is a felony in Massachusetts. A conviction or even a continuance without a finding would have resulted in our client losing his job. We scheduled the case for trial. On the day of trial we were able to get this charge dismissed.
